Role Summary

Director, Regulatory Labeling Operations

Responsibilities

  • Oversee Regulatory Labeling Operations in the development, revision, and approval of packaging component artworks for marketed products and products in full development; oversee submission-ready labeling documents.
  • Manage interface with Manufacturing/Supply Chain, Regulatory Operations, and labeling vendors; lead or support labeling content and/or artwork system development and implementation; support labeling SOPs or work instructions.
  • Lead Regulatory Labeling Operations in development, revision, and approval of packaging component artworks (carton, container labeling, printed package insert) for full development and marketed products.
  • Advise Packaging Teams to ensure packaging content and artworks comply with internal labeling policies, SOPs, and worldwide regulations.
  • Manage Regulatory Labeling Operations Group; provide training and guidance for direct reports.
  • Manage relationships with internal stakeholders and labeling vendors (SPL, translations, readability, QC tool).
  • Provide labeling expertise to novel packaging design initiatives.
  • Collaborate to develop and implement labeling content and/or artwork management system solutions.
  • Support operational labeling deliverables including SPL, EMA translations/linguistic reviews, submission-ready labeling documents, proofreading/QC, and labeling contributions to periodic reports.
  • Monitor worldwide regulatory changes pertaining to labeling.
  • Support creation or revision of labeling SOPs or work instructions.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ree (BS) from an accredited college or university, preferably in Health/Science, or 10+ years of industry experience.
  • In-depth knowledge of worldwide regulatory agencies, industry practice, packaging manufacturing, and the drug development process; familiarity with FDA, EMEA, and international packaging regulations for biologic and combination products.
  • 10-15+ years of biotech or pharma industry experience in regulatory labeling and packaging, with some management experience.
  • Experience implementing new corporate labeling and/or artwork systems.
  • Experience managing labeling process initiatives.
  • Ability to lead/advice cross-functional packaging teams to navigate labeling issues, develop action plans, and resolve complex issues.
  • Ability to work independently, use judgment, and escalate problems appropriately.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ects and prioritize work for self and direct reports.
  • Attention to detail and strong word processing and organizational skills.
